The garage occupancy feed for the Brindlewood campus arrives over a message queue every thirty seconds, one record per level, published by the Stallgrid edge boxes. Counts can briefly go negative when a sensor double-fires on exit; the ingest job clamps these to zero and flags the interval. If the feed stalls for more than five minutes, the dashboard falls back to the last known snapshot. Sensor mappings, queue names, and the replay procedure are documented on the internal page below.

runbook for tahog-kadug: https://gitlab.qirvanworks.corp/projects/pages/view/b139298aed28

Subject: Thumbnail queue — on-call notes

Welcome, Tomas. The Pixelgrove thumbnail queue backs up most Mondays. Symptoms: stale previews, consumer lag alerts. Fix: restart the worker pool, then drain the dead-letter topic. Don't purge the queue — that loses customer uploads. Escalate only if lag exceeds two hours after restart. Full drain procedure and dashboards are on the internal page below.

dashboard of tawef-yageg = https://jira.torvaworks.corp/deploy/merge_requests/board/settings/issue/settings/build/86c86b97dff3e2041bd6f497

All requests must be authenticated with a channel-scoped key; unsigned bundles are rejected at ingest, and the manifest digest is re-verified before fan-out to devices. Keys are scoped per channel, cannot publish cross-channel, and expire after ninety days. For security review purposes, the staging channel uses an isolated keyspace with no path to production devices. The current staging publish key is shown below.

gateway credential: kto23_dolYgAScEh2TaPOlStqOl98

**Ticket: Signature check failing on Gatewise circuit breaker release**

The v3.2 breaker module for the upstream Ferrow API fails verification in CI. Cause: the old signing key was retired last sprint but the pipeline config wasn't updated. Breaker thresholds are unchanged; only the signature is stale. Maintainers: re-sign the artifact and update the pipeline secret. Re-sign using the current deploy key below.

rollout seal: bky9_aBG1gvAyU